Bleach, Vol. 49 The Lost Agent by Tite Kubo is published by VIZ Media LLC and was released on October 2, 2012. This edition contains 192 pages and is presented in English. The story continues the paranormal action-adventure of Ichigo Kurosaki, who, after losing his Soul Reaper powers, attempts to lead a quiet life. However, his peace is disrupted when a mysterious man approaches him, raising questions about the connection to his lost abilities.

Readers will find a blend of fantasy and action as Ichigo navigates the challenges posed by his new circumstances. The narrative explores themes of duty and the supernatural, characteristic of the manga genre. With its engaging storyline, this volume contributes to the ongoing saga of Ichigo’s journey, offering insights into his character and the world of Soul Reapers.

Ichigo Kurosaki never asked for the ability to see ghosts–he was born with the gift. When his family is attacked by a Hollow–a malevolent lost soul–Ichigo becomes a Soul Reaper, dedicating his life to protecting the innocent and helping the tortured spirits themselves find peace. Find out why Tite Kubo’s Bleach has become an international manga smash-hit!

After a long battle, Ichigo loses his Soul Reaper powers… Ichigo now leads a quiet and peaceful life until he is approached by a mysterious man. What does the man want and how does it relate to Ichigo’s lost powers?!
